Description

Getting new employees up to speed on the culture, processes, and knowledge base of a company can cost up to 30% of a new hire’s annual salary. Meanwhile, most employees perform at only a quarter of their full productivity for the first month in their role - unsurprising given that many companies dedicate only a week or less to onboard employees.

Your business can’t afford an onboarding bottleneck. Optimizing your onboarding process can help reduce early turnover by as much as 25% and save the nearly $11,000 it costs to fill a new vacancy. Not only does strategic onboarding save money, it helps boost revenue by quickly ramping new hires to peak productivity. 

To remain competitive in a cutthroat market, L&D decision-makers must standardize, optimize, and accelerate employee onboarding and training so that new hires become productive and add value as soon as possible.

About Chris Knowlton

Chris Knowlton is a passionate technology leader for products that empower organizations by unlocking the power of video. He has spent the last 22 years identifying, building, and evangelizing strategic video solutions to real-world customer challenges for schools and businesses of all sizes. A recognized industry authority, Chris was honored in 2011 as a Streaming Media All-Star by Streaming Media magazine for his impact on the industry and holds several patents for streaming software technologies.

Before Panopto, Chris held product management and executive roles at Wowza Media Systems, BlueFrame Technology, and Microsoft. He helped set cross-product strategies for numerous on-premises and cloud video delivery technologies, including Wowza Streaming Engine, Wowza Cloud, Windows Media Services, Smooth Streaming, Azure Media Services, and Microsoft Stream. Before focusing exclusively on software, Chris worked in alliance management at NetApp and at several Tier 1 automotive suppliers. He holds a bachelor of science degree in mechanical engineering from Michigan State University.
